News Nurture Group awarded Armed Forces Covenant Employer Recognition Scheme Gold Award Date: 17th July 2026 Share: Nurture Group is proud to announce that it has been awarded the Armed Forces Covenant Employer Recognition Scheme (ERS) Gold Award – the Ministry of Defence’s highest recognition for employers demonstrating exceptional and sustained support for the Armed Forces community. The Gold Award recognises organisations that go beyond their Armed Forces Covenant commitments by creating Forces-friendly workplaces where veterans, Reservists, military families and Cadet Force Adult Volunteers are supported to succeed. This year, Nurture Group is one of just 162 organisations across the UK to receive the prestigious award. A commitment that goes beyond the award Receiving Gold reflects the work Nurture Group has undertaken over the past 20 months to strengthen its support for the Armed Forces community. This has included enhancing HR policies for Reservists, building partnerships with Armed Forces recruitment organisations, promoting Forces-friendly careers, supporting Defence charities and raising awareness of the Armed Forces Covenant across the business. The award also recognises Nurture Group’s ongoing commitment to attracting the valuable skills, leadership and resilience that service personnel bring to civilian careers. It also reflects the expectations of many of the Group’s defence sector clients, who look to work with organisations that demonstrate a genuine and lasting commitment to the Armed Forces community. A proud part of our heritage Supporting the Armed Forces community is closely linked to Nurture Group’s history. Following the acquisition of Gavin Jones in 2018, the Group inherited a remarkable legacy. Colonel Gavin Jones founded the business in 1919 after returning from military service, building a company that would become one of the UK’s most respected landscaping businesses. Today, that connection continues through Nurture Group’s commitment to supporting veterans, Reservists and military families as they transition into rewarding civilian careers.
